Soils, Geodiversity and Soils Educational Site Networks
Soil science is poorly recognised by existing designated sites, and can be side-lined in environmental education. This important meeting explores whether linking soils with geodiversity conservation efforts could help to develop networks of educational soil science sites, to act as a framework for understanding the role of soils in earth sciences and wider society. Topics will include
- the place of soils in geodiversity
- identifying soils sites for educational purposes
- the role of local level designations in protecting and promoting soil sites
An afternoon field trip will explore how sites could be interpreted and used. There will be no conference fee, as the meeting is supported by the British Society of Soil Science. Lunch will be provided at a cost of £10 per head. The meeting will be followed by the SWESDG AGM.
